Khargosha is an inhabited village in Yamkeshwar Sub-district of Garhwal district, Uttarakhand. Its Census village code is 048627, the Census 2011 record lists 39 people in 8 households and the reported area is 62.78 hectares. The local references include Kuthar Gram Panchayat, Yamkeshwar CD Block and the nearest town reference is Rishikesh at about 35 km.

These Census 2011 identifiers place Khargosha in the official administrative record. Census village code 048627, Kuthar Gram Panchayat and Yamkeshwar CD Block.
Rishikesh is the nearest town listed for Khargosha, about 35 km away. Pauri is listed as the district headquarters at about 181 km. These distances are useful for orientation, not for survey, boundary or emergency use.
The Census 2011 record lists 39 people in 8 households, with 20 male residents and 19 female residents. The average household size is 4.88, and SC share is 0% and ST share is 0% for Khargosha. Population density works out to about 62.12 people per sq km.
Drinking-water and sanitation entries for Khargosha include treated tap water. These are historical facility records, not a live water-quality guarantee.
Connectivity records for Khargosha include mobile phone coverage. Use them as access clues and confirm present conditions locally.
Public-service entries for Khargosha include self-help groups. Banking rows on this page are shown separately because they use RBI-sourced bank service records.
Domestic power supply for Khargosha is reported as 16 hours per day in summer and 20 hours per day in winter. Treat this as historical Census/District Census Handbook data.
Land-use records for Khargosha show that reported agricultural commodities include Ragi and net sown area is 2.26 hectares. These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
